As of 2023, China and the United States are the world's second- and first-largest economies by nominal GDP, as well as the first and second-largest economies by GDP (PPP) respectively. Collectively, they account for 44.2% of the global nominal GDP, and 34.7% of global PPP-adjusted GDP.The next century may well be defined in part by the tension between the American dream and the Chinese dream. China attains a maximum gdp growth rate of 19.30% in 1970 and a minimum of -27.27% in 1961. During the period 1961 to 2019, China grew by more than 10% in 22 years. The United States reached an all-time high of 7.24% in 1984 and a record low of -2.54% in 2009.

American business practices tend to rely more on the negotiation and law of contracts rather than facilitating a long ...China has an upper middle income, developing, mixed, socialist market economy incorporating industrial policies and strategic five-year plans. It is the world's second largest economy by nominal GDP, behind the United States, and the world's largest economy since 2016 when measured by purchasing power parity (PPP).
